Failed findings

  • Food And Non-Food Contact Surfaces Properly Designed, Constructed And Maintained
    Inspector note: Broken caulking around the exposed hand sink,mop sink and three compartment sink.remove/replace caulking with a smooth cleanable and non-absorbent surface
    code 32
  • food prep surfaces dirty
    Official wording: Food And Non-Food Contact Equipment Utensils Clean, Free Of Abrasive Detergents
    Inspector note: Debris inside the oven and all smoke cooking equipment,instructed to clean and maintain
    code 33
  • Floors: Constructed Per Code, Cleaned, Good Repair, Coving Installed, Dust-Less Cleaning Methods Used
    Inspector note: Floor under the smoke cooking equipment is completely covered with black grimes,instructed to clean and maintain
    code 34
  • Walls, Ceilings, Attached Equipment Constructed Per Code: Good Repair, Surfaces Clean And Dust-Less Cleaning Methods
    Inspector note: Wall under the three compartment sink with encrusted food and spider webs,also wall inside the smoke area,instructed to clean and maintain
    code 35
  • pests in the house
    Official wording: Ventilation: Rooms And Equipment Vented As Required: Plumbing: Installed And Maintained
    Inspector note: Faucet at mop sink heavily leaking,instructed to repair.Water pipe under the two compartment sink,instructed to repair
    code 38
  • Refrigeration And Metal Stem Thermometers Provided And Conspicuous
    Inspector note: No thermometer provide inside the hot holding unit instructed to provide
    code 40
